A unique institution taking hold at the Indian School of Business (ISB) is the ISB Super League, or ISL. Launched in 2010, the ISL pits teams of ISB students against each other in head-to-head intramural combat in ten different sports, including cricket, soccer, Frisbee, basketball and water polo, over the course of three months. Gayatri Reddy, co-owner of the Deccan Chargers, attended the kickoff event to launch ISL 2011, and Accenture officially sponsored 2011’s four franchises—the Hyderabad Nizams, the Titans, the Raging Bulls and the Hurricanes—which competed for points and ultimately the Super League Cup in the ten different events. The ISL franchises are selected via a live fantasy auction, in which students bid for the teams and players using real money. The players for each team are then “sold” in a live auction using virtual currency. The winning team takes home 60% of the prize money accrued from the bids, the second- and third-place teams split 35% of the prize money, and the remaining 5% covers tournament organization costs.
